Job Description
Pricing Operations Analyst
Caseware
• SKU taxonomy & lifecycle: Design and maintain a scalable SKU hierarchy for bundles, add-ons, usage/overage, and regional variants; govern naming, attributes, and deprecation. • Price book management: Build/maintain global and regional price books, including FX, rounding rules, customer segments, and promotional/launch credits. • CPQ configuration: Implement product rules, dependency logic, guided selling, approval thresholds, and discount/term constraints aligned to strategy. • Change control & audit: Operate a formal price/SKU change process with versioning, effective dates, approvals, and SOX-friendly documentation. • Data quality & reporting: Reconcile CPQ/ERP/CRM price data; monitor price realization, SKU adoption, and quoting accuracy; publish weekly dashboards. • Renewal & migration enablement: Create migration SKUs, mapping tables, and auto-renew rules to support bundling-first and tier upgrades. • Tool stewardship: Partner with Sales Ops, IT, and Finance to align CPQ, ERP (e.g., NetSuite), billing, and data warehouse; drive automation and reduce quote cycle time. • Support field readiness: Provide release notes, quick guides, and training for new SKUs/price rules.
Job Requirements
- Up to 3 years in Pricing Operations, CPQ administration, or Product Operations within B2B SaaS.
- Hands-on Salesforce CPQ (or equivalent) experience configuring products, price rules, approvals, and quote templates.
- Practical knowledge of ERP/billing (NetSuite, Oracle, Zuora) and how SKUs flow through order-to-cash.
- Advanced Excel/Sheets; working SQL; comfort with large data reconciliation and VLOOKUP/INDEX-MATCH mastery.
- Detail-obsessed with strong documentation discipline and change-management acumen.
- Nice to Have :
- Experience with pricing platforms (Pricefx/PROS/Vendavo) and data tools (dbt, Fivetran) or scripting (Python).
- Channel/distributor pricing exposure and regional localization workflows.
- Success Measures (12 Months): 99%+ quote accuracy; <24h average quote turnaround for standard deals.
- Clean SKU catalog with deprecation of legacy items and zero duplicate SKUs.
- Timely, error-free price book refreshes and audit-ready change logs.
- Reduced discount approval escalations via CPQ guardrails.
- 30/60/90 Day Plan (Outcomes):
- 30 days: Inventory current SKUs/price books, map systems and owners, document change process.
- 60 days: Deliver cleaned SKU taxonomy and initial CPQ rule set; publish weekly price realization dashboard.
- 90 days: Launch new price books/launch credit mechanics; complete first audit of quote accuracy and cycle time improvements
